Post by Cheffe »

Hi :wave:
pretty much everyone says the one available at Wal-Mart with Largo 1977 on it, simply because this is the only thing which was not available before anywhere else... all the others have been circulating already before...

Post by (((theNEWgod))) »

i bought all 3, and i gotta say, the largo show is by faaar the BEST. yes, it's kool seeing a new show that you've never seen, but also just cuz the quality is awesome, the lighting is much better than the houston show, the picture is more vivid, and pops off my screen. yes, there are SLIGHT rolling lines at parts. this ONLY happens when the :kiss: sign lights up bright (when you see it you'll know what i'm talkin about). the rest is PERFECT. very clear picture for the whole show. better camera angles too. i really love this show. this IS :kiss: . understand, '77 was my favorite era, so that's also why i choose this disc. cobo hall roxx ass too, but the largo show is probably my fav :kiss: live dvd ever, bootlegs included. it has a raw feel, and looks great. this disc also has chapter breaks, and a menu.

the walmart one was HELL to find. i went to 4 walmarts 3 days in a row, and only ONE of them had it, and only two on the shelf. i grabbed 'em both. i went there on my lunch breaks and after work. 3 of the stores say they never even received them! and here, i thought the walmart version would be the heaviest distributed. ooops.

one thing i really think that hella suxx about this set is that they didn't include " detroit rock city" from the paul lynde show. AWESOME performance, only one little song to add to the set. it hurtz in my gut that wasn't remastered and properly immortalized. but, hell, i'm happy to have what we have. i thought i'd never see the day.
